THE EMPLOYEES STATE INSURANCE ACT,1948 An Act to provide for certain benefits to employees in case of sickness, maternity and employment injury and to make provision for certain other matters in relation thereto. It is mandatory to deduct ESIC of each individual falling Gross salary below RS. 15000/- under ESIC Act-1948 The amount is divided into two deductions /contributions. One is of employer and another is from employee. Employer Contribution is 4.75% of the Gross Salary. Employee Contribution is 1.75% of Gross Salary. Total ESIC Contribution is 6.50% of Gross Salary. THE EMPLOYEE s PROVIDENT FUND ACT-1952 This act is to provide a kind of Social Security to the employees. The Act mainly provides retirement or old age benefits, such as Provident Fund, Superannuation Pension, Invalidation Pension, Family Pension and Deposit Linked Insurance. Employees who have been appointed on Basic salary of Rs 6500 or less are covered under the provision of the EPF Act, right from the day of commencement of their work. For more than Rs 6500 (Basic Salary) it s on the discretion of Employee and Employer to come under EPF Act but not mandatory. Percentage of contribution to be deducted from employees part is 12% of Basic Salary. Employer Contribution is 12% of Basic Salary and addition to this 1.61% of Basic Salary is also paid as Admin Charges. So in total 13.61% is Employer Contribution towards EPF. Compliances under EPF Act- Form 2- Declaration form for new joinees- At the time of joining Form 13- Transfer of PF Account- When new recruit Form 11- Declare previous employment details, if any, in Form 11 of the Employer (in this form its mentioned that whether he was Under EPF Act previously or not, if the candidate don t want to come under EPF act he has to chose the option No)

PAYMENT OF BONUS ACT 1965 As Per amendment to the Payment of Bonus Act 1965, all employees drawing a basic salary (Base Pay) of less than or equal to Rs.10,000/- per month are eligible for Bonus. If Basic salary is less then Rs.3500/- then bonus is 8.33 % of the basic. If basic is more than Rs.3500/- then minimum bonus is Rs.292/- per month payable annually. If basic is more than Rs.10000.00 then person is not entitled for bonus. Bonus Payment is as per statutory requirement. This is not a performance bonus or performance linked Incentive. Payment condition of bonus: Employees should work more than 30 days. Bonus is paid once in a year Year start from 01 st of April end on 31 st of March Bonus from April to March(Financial Year)-will be paid on or before 31 st October.
ACCIDENTAL INSURANCE POLICY INSURANCE (If applicable) V5 provides Accidental Insurance cover to all its ISD s. Rs. 50/- per month s deducted from the ISD s salary. Death only - 100% Loss of two limbs, two eyes - 100% Loss of one limb or one eye-50% Permanent Total Disablement from injuries other than those named above (PTD-100%) Permanent Partial Disablement specified % of CSI as Detailed in the Policy Temporary Total Disablement 1% of CSI per week up to 104 weeks maximum.
